About the Business
Yancoal Australia is Australia's largest pure play coal producer. It boasts three tier one thermal coal mines in New South Wales together with interests in three other metallurgical and thermal coal mines located in New South Wales and Queensland. Yancoal Australia also manages five other Australian coal mines on behalf of related parties. Yancoal currently employs over 3,000 people across its operations.
